Prayer times in Saint-Georges — common questions
What time is Fajr in Saint-Georges today?
Fajr in Saint-Georges begins at 03:18 AM today. Fajr starts at true dawn, when the sun reaches a set angle below the horizon, and ends at sunrise — so this time shifts by a minute or two each day as the season changes.
Which direction is the Qibla from Saint-Georges?
From Saint-Georges, the Qibla is 60.8° from true north — roughly ENE. Remember that a phone compass points to magnetic north, so you may need to correct for local magnetic declination.
Which calculation method is used for Saint-Georges?
These times use the MWL convention, which is the standard recognised across Canada. If your mosque follows a different authority, its Fajr and Isha may differ by several minutes — the calculation is identical, only the twilight angle changes.
How far is Saint-Georges from Makkah?
Saint-Georges lies approximately 9770 km from the Kaaba in Makkah, measured as a great circle across the Earth's surface. That distance is what determines the Qibla bearing shown above.
How much does daylight change through the year in Saint-Georges?
Day length in Saint-Georges ranges from about 8.6 hours at midwinter to 15.8 hours at midsummer — a swing of roughly 7.2 hours. This is why Fajr and Isha move so much between seasons while Dhuhr stays close to midday.
